Founded in 1919 and headquartered in Memphis, Tennessee, The Lilly Company has established itself as a critical provider of rental services for industrial and construction equipment. The company operates at the intersection of logistics and heavy machinery, offering a comprehensive suite of solutions that enable contractors and industrial operators to maintain project momentum without the prohibitive costs of asset ownership. By focusing on reliability and technical support, the firm has cultivated a robust market position, serving as a vital partner for regional and national construction entities. Their business model emphasizes the lifecycle management of high-value assets, ensuring that clients have access to the latest technology and equipment standards required for modern safety and efficiency protocols.
